Abstract

The invention relates to a fine grinding and polishing device, in particular to a fine grinding and polishing device for the surface of a small plano-convex lens. The technical problem is how to design a surface fine grinding and polishing equipment for small plano-convex lenses that can replace manual grinding and polishing of small plano-convex lenses, which is relatively labor-saving and has a good effect of fine grinding and polishing. A small plano-convex lens surface fine grinding and polishing equipment, comprising: a base, a support frame is fixedly connected to the edge of one side of the base; and a support plate is fixed to the middle of one side of the base. In the present invention, by placing the small-sized plano-convex lens on the placement tray and pressing and fixing it by hand, and pulling the pedal to move downward, the sliding rod can drive the deceleration motor to move downward, and the grinding wheel also moves downward to contact the small plano-convex lens. Start the deceleration motor to drive the grinding wheel to rotate, and the grinding wheel rotates to finely grind and polish the small plano-convex lens. In this way, people do not need to manually perform fine grinding and polishing, which is labor-saving and has a good fine grinding and polishing effect.

Description

technical field [0001] The invention relates to a fine grinding and polishing device, in particular to a fine grinding and polishing device for the surface of a small plano-convex lens. Background technique [0002] During the processing of small plano-convex lenses, a large number of burrs will appear on the surface of small plano-convex lenses, and the small plano-convex lenses need to be finely ground and polished to make the small plano-convex lenses smoother. At present, most of the small plano-convex lenses are manually fine-ground Polishing, first of all, people hold a small plano-convex lens in one hand, and the other hand holds a grinding tool to perform fine grinding and polishing on the small plano-convex lens.
